영카트5 상품 썸네일 채택완료
용좌
11년 전
조회 13,672
썸네일 관련 질문입니다.
상품 썸네일을 만드는 함수는
get_it_image
이 함수입니다. 근데
설명서에서도 그렇듯이 높이를 지정 안하면 자동적으로 높이는 비율에 맞게 나옵니다.
근데 저는 높이만 지정을 하여서 자동적으로 넓이가 비율에 맞게 나오게 하고 싶은데 어느 부분을 수정을 해야 할까요..?
예) width=200 height=0 //이면 가로가 200이고 세로가 랜덤으로 비율에 맞게 나옵니다.
-> width= 0 height=200//이렇게 해서 가로는 자동으로 늘어나고 세로가 200인 비율에 맞게 나오게 하고 싶습니다.
도움 좀 부탁드리겠습니다.
댓글을 작성하려면 로그인이 필요합니다.
답변 1개
채택된 답변
+20 포인트
11년 전
shop.lib.php 파일의 get_it_image 함수 코드 중 아래 부분을 수정하셔야 할 것으로 보입니다.
</div>
<div><div> if(!$it_id || !$width)</div>
<div> return '';</div></div>
<div>
</div>
<div><div> if($img_width && !$height) {</div>
<div> $height = round(($width * $img_height) / $img_width);</div>
<div> }</div></div>
<div>
전달된 width 값을 기준으로 height 를 구하는 부분이며 이 부분을 height를 기준으로 width 를 구하도록
코드를 수정하시면 사용이 가능할 것으로 보입니다.
로그인 후 평가할 수 있습니다
답변에 대한 댓글 1개
�
용좌
11년 전
댓글을 작성하려면 로그인이 필요합니다.
답변을 작성하려면 로그인이 필요합니다.
로그인
근데 역시 이건 이것대로 문제가 있네요...
역시 편리님이 쵝오! 빠르고 바른 답변 감사합니다!!!